About Patient Care Technician - 5 East Acute Care/Trauma Stepdown - FT Nights

  UPMC Williamsport has an opening for a Full-Time Nights Patient Care Technician to join 5 East! 5 East is an Acute Care/Trauma Stepdown Unit.

  This position will be scheduled 36 hours per week and will work 6:30 p.m. to 6:30 a.m. This role will also be assigned every other weekend/holiday!

  *Final candidates will be selected for a job title within the career ladder that reflects level of education, experience, and manager discretion at time of offer. *

  Responsibilities:

  Provides patient care including assisting with patient procedures and activities of daily living. Assists with physical, respiratory and cardiopulmonary therapies. Provides feedback to the RN regarding patient care and reports changes in patient status.

  Performs the UPMC nursing core nursing assistant responsibilities (blood glucose, weights, vital signs, I&O, specimen collections and Foley care) AND at least four of the following BU identified tasks: phlebotomy, 12 lead EKG, simple dressing, Foley catheter removal, point of care testing, bladder scan, straight catheter, or IV catheter removal.

  In addition to the required standard competencies, the Patient Care Technician will achieve and maintain competency and/or perform at least 1 or more of the following advanced skills based on department operational need: phlebotomy/venipuncture, peripheral IV removal, indwelling Foley catheter removal, basic arrythmia, 12-lead EKG, and NG tubes clamping and removal.

  ? High school diploma or equivalent. ? Must also have either a) 1 Year of general healthcare experience, OR b) 6 months of experience as UPMC Nursing Assistant/CNA with PCT competency achieved within 120 days of hire/transfer/promotion, ORc) enrollment in PT/OT/PA program or related healthcare training program with completion of at least one clinical rotation, OR d) completion of a bachelor?s degree in a health sciences field. ? Successful completion of UPMC patient care technician class? Successful completion of basic information system training. ? Microcomputer experience preferred. ? Ability to effectively communicate both orally and in writing. ? Emergency Medical Technician (EMT)or Paramedic or currently enrolled in an EMT or Paramedic program preferred. ? Access to medications is limited to the distribution of the medication to the nurse.

  Licensure, Certifications, and Clearances:

  CPR required based on AHA standards that include both a didactic and skills demonstration component within 30 days of hire

  CPR required based on AHA standards that include both a didactic and skills demonstration component within 30 days of hire ACLS preferred

  Basic Life Support (BLS) OR Cardiopulmonary Resuscitation (CPR)
